Uji City and Kyoto Animation are intrinsically bonded and to celebrate this bond, the two have teamed up for a promotional campaign for the historic city. The collaboration was first announced last October with a visual and since then a 30-second anime commercial for the campaign was released back in March and now the full six-minute anime has been released on Uji City’s YouTube channel. The full animation was originally exclusive to Uji City geographically, only available to those inside the city while sharing their location. Now though, anyone can enjoy the anime short about highlighting the romantic history of the area centered around Murasaki Shikibu’s The Tale of Genji . Uji is one the oldest and most historic towns in Japan with centuries-old locations dotted throughout the area. Uji’s long history is full of war, love, tragedy and more, all dating back to the Heian period and further.

Uji City and Kyoto Animation have a very strong bond. Not only is Sound! Euphonium , one of the studio’s current flagship anime, set in the area, but it is also where the studio is located, with many of the staff living in and around the city. Because of this bond, the two partnered up for a tourism campaign to highlight the romantic history of the area centered around Murasaki Shikibu’s The Tale of Genji . The campaign was originally announced in October 2023 with a gorgeous visual. Yesterday, a commercial for the town keeping with the same historical context from the poster was brought to life in a way only the staff at Kyoto Animation can. The short 30-second version of the video is available above, but a longer six-minute version will be available inside Uji City from March 9 through location sharing on your smartphone.
